Your guide meets you at your hotel in an air-conditioned vehicle and heads straight to the Giza Plateau, on the outskirts of Cairo. There you'll see all three Great Pyramids—Khufu's, the largest and oldest of the group; Khafre's, which still holds fragments of its original limestone casing near the summit; and Menkaure's, smaller in scale but no less deliberate in its construction. Your guide walks you through the engineering questions Egyptologists still debate the funerary role each pyramid served, not just the dates and dimensions.

From the pyramids, you'll move to the Great Sphinx and the Valley Temple of Khafre, where priests once carried out purification rites before a pharaoh's burial. It's a shorter stop but a dense one—the Sphinx's lion body and human face, the temple's granite construction, and why this exact spot was chosen for it.
